Re: Entity Modeler fails to show model

From: Mike Schrag (mschra..dimension.com)
Date: Mon May 21 2007 - 14:25:58 EDT

  • Next message: Mike Schrag (JIRA): "[OS-JIRA] Created: (WOL-459) Refactor: Extract to Component"

    That should probably manifest in a nicer way .. At least an error
    dialog.

    ms

    On May 21, 2007, at 2:23 PM, Cedarstone wrote:

    > woops!
    >
    > Yes that's it. I have swapped an un-mangled version in and it all
    > works nicely now.
    >
    > Sorry.
    >
    > Giles
    >
    >> Yikes -- You've somehow managed to get an xml plist instead of the
    >> old style plist for your entity. Did you open this and resave it
    >> with Property List Editor by any chance? I've never seen an
    >> eomodel in xml format.
    >>
    >> ms
    >>
    >> On May 21, 2007, at 1:59 PM, Cedarstone wrote:
    >>
    >>> Mike
    >>>
    >>> Much appreciated. Attached.
    >>>
    >>> Giles
    >>>
    >>> <Transaction.plist>
    >>>
    >>>
    >>>> Can you email me My.eomodeld/Transaction.plist ? That sounds
    >>>> really suspicious. It would appear that parsing that file
    >>>> returned a single String instead of a Map, which would imply to
    >>>> me that there's a String at the root level of that plist instead
    >>>> of a Map. Which seems ... really wrong.
    >>>>
    >>>> ms
    >>>>
    >>>> On May 21, 2007, at 1:11 PM, Cedarstone wrote:
    >>>>
    >>>>> Hi
    >>>>>
    >>>>> I have just upgraded to the latest WOLips and Eclipse:
    >>>>>
    >>>>> Eclipse Version: 3.2.2 Build id: M20070212-1330
    >>>>> WOlips 2.0.0.4043
    >>>>> On OS X & Java 1.5
    >>>>>
    >>>>> When I try to open an EOModel or an entity the Entity Modeler
    >>>>> perspective opens but all is blank. I don't get any error in
    >>>>> the Eclipse error log but in the console I get the below.
    >>>>>
    >>>>> Is WOLips etc OK with 3.2.2?
    >>>>>
    >>>>> Any ideas?
    >>>>>
    >>>>> Thanks
    >>>>>
    >>>>> Giles
    >>>>>
    >>>>>
    >>>>>
    >>>>> EOModelGroup.loadModelFromFolder: file:/Users/giles/Documents/
    >>>>> workspace/ServerEOs/My.eomodeld/, file:/Users/giles/Documents/
    >>>>> workspace/ServerEOs/My.eomodeld/
    >>>>> org.objectstyle.wolips.eomodeler.core.model.EOModelException:
    >>>>> Failed to load entity from 'file:/Users/giles/Documents/
    >>>>> workspace/ServerEOs/My.eomodeld/Transaction.plist'.
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.core.model.EOEntity.loadFromURL
    >>>>> (Unknown Source)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.core.model.EOModel.loadFromFolder
    >>>>> (Unknown Source)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.core.model.EOModelGroup.loadModel
    >>>>> FromFolder(Unknown Source)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.eclipse.EclipseEOModelGroupFactor
    >>>>> y$ModelVisitor.visit(Unknown Source)
    >>>>> at org.eclipse.core.internal.resources.Resource$2.visit
    >>>>> (Resource.java:105)
    >>>>> at org.eclipse.core.internal.resources.Resource$1.visitElement
    >>>>> (Resource.java:57)
    >>>>> at
    >>>>> org.eclipse.core.internal.watson.ElementTreeIterator.doIteration
    >>>>> (ElementTreeIterator.java:81)
    >>>>> at
    >>>>> org.eclipse.core.internal.watson.ElementTreeIterator.doIteration
    >>>>> (ElementTreeIterator.java:85)
    >>>>> at org.eclipse.core.internal.watson.ElementTreeIterator.iterate
    >>>>> (ElementTreeIterator.java:126)
    >>>>> at org.eclipse.core.internal.resources.Resource.accept
    >>>>> (Resource.java:67)
    >>>>> at org.eclipse.core.internal.resources.Resource.accept
    >>>>> (Resource.java:103)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.eclipse.EclipseEOModelGroupFactor
    >>>>> y.addModelsFromProject(Unknown Source)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.eclipse.EclipseEOModelGroupFactor
    >>>>> y.loadModelGroup(Unknown Source)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.eclipse.EclipseEOModelGroupFactor
    >>>>> y.createModel(Unknown Source)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.eclipse.EclipseEOModelGroupFactor
    >>>>> y.loadModel(Unknown Source)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.core.model.IEOModelGroupFactory
    >>>>> $Utility.loadModel(Unknown Source)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.editors.EOModelEditor.loadInBackg
    >>>>> round(Unknown Source)
    >>>>> at org.objectstyle.wolips.eomodeler.editors.EOModelEditor$2
    >>>>> $1.run(Unknown Source)
    >>>>> at org.eclipse.jface.operation.ModalContext
    >>>>> $ModalContextThread.run(ModalContext.java:113)
    >>>>> Caused by: java.lang.ClassCastException: java.lang.String
    >>>>> ... 19 more
    >>>>> org.objectstyle.wolips.eomodeler.core.model.EOModelException:
    >>>>> Failed to load EOModel from 'L/ServerEOs/My.eomodeld/
    >>>>> Transaction.plist'.
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.eclipse.EclipseEOModelGroupFactor
    >>>>> y.loadModel(Unknown Source)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.core.model.IEOModelGroupFactory
    >>>>> $Utility.loadModel(Unknown Source)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.editors.EOModelEditor.loadInBackg
    >>>>> round(Unknown Source)
    >>>>> at org.objectstyle.wolips.eomodeler.editors.EOModelEditor$2
    >>>>> $1.run(Unknown Source)
    >>>>> at org.eclipse.jface.operation.ModalContext
    >>>>> $ModalContextThread.run(ModalContext.java:113)
    >>>>> Caused by: org.eclipse.core.runtime.CoreException: Failed to
    >>>>> load model in F/ServerEOs/My.eomodeld:
    >>>>> org.objectstyle.wolips.eomodeler.core.model.EOModelException:
    >>>>> Failed to load entity from 'file:/Users/giles/Documents/
    >>>>> workspace/ServerEOs/My.eomodeld/Transaction.plist'.
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.eclipse.EclipseEOModelGroupFactor
    >>>>> y$ModelVisitor.visit(Unknown Source)
    >>>>> at org.eclipse.core.internal.resources.Resource$2.visit
    >>>>> (Resource.java:105)
    >>>>> at org.eclipse.core.internal.resources.Resource$1.visitElement
    >>>>> (Resource.java:57)
    >>>>> at
    >>>>> org.eclipse.core.internal.watson.ElementTreeIterator.doIteration
    >>>>> (ElementTreeIterator.java:81)
    >>>>> at
    >>>>> org.eclipse.core.internal.watson.ElementTreeIterator.doIteration
    >>>>> (ElementTreeIterator.java:85)
    >>>>> at org.eclipse.core.internal.watson.ElementTreeIterator.iterate
    >>>>> (ElementTreeIterator.java:126)
    >>>>> at org.eclipse.core.internal.resources.Resource.accept
    >>>>> (Resource.java:67)
    >>>>> at org.eclipse.core.internal.resources.Resource.accept
    >>>>> (Resource.java:103)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.eclipse.EclipseEOModelGroupFactor
    >>>>> y.addModelsFromProject(Unknown Source)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.eclipse.EclipseEOModelGroupFactor
    >>>>> y.loadModelGroup(Unknown Source)
    >>>>> at
    >>>>> org.objectstyle.wolips.eomodeler.eclipse.EclipseEOModelGroupFactor
    >>>>> y.createModel(Unknown Source)
    >>>>> ... 5 more
    >>>>>
    >>>>
    >>>>
    >>>
    >>
    >>
    >



    This archive was generated by hypermail 2.0.0 : Mon May 21 2007 - 14:27:00 EDT